Several abandoned/inactive mines:
- Chada da Horta (Ba), mining concession no. 2458, registered on 13-12-1949
- Corga da Mula (Pb), min. conc. no. 50, reg. on 18-01-1869
- Fonte dos Barbaços (Pb), min. conc. no. 51, reg. on 18-01-1869
- Quinhão do Monte Branco no. 1 (Ba), min. conc. no. 2435, reg. on 01-11-1949
- Cerro do Ouro/Herdade dos Namorados (Mn), min. conc. no. 324, reg. on 29-10-1900
